Mortgage Basics: Fixed vs. Adjustable Rate
Signing a mortgage is one of the biggest financial commitments of your life. Make sure you understand the difference between FRM and ARM loans involving thousands of dollars.
Feb 15, 2026
Inventory Batches
$1,600
COGS
$600
Ending Inventory
A warehouse manager stares at a shelf of artisanal coffee beans, knowing the bags purchased last month must leave the building before the fresh shipment arrives today. You need to identify the exact cost associated with the units currently heading to customers, rather than guessing based on current market prices. This tool handles the sequence of costs, ensuring your financial reporting mirrors the reality of your stock rotation.
The First-In, First-Out (FIFO) method is a fundamental accounting principle designed to reflect the physical flow of goods. Originating from the need to prevent spoilage in industries like food and pharmaceuticals, it assumes that the earliest items brought into inventory are the first ones sold. By matching older, historical costs against current revenue, it provides a realistic valuation of ending inventory. This practice aligns with Generally Accepted Accounting Principles (GAAP) and International Financial Reporting Standards (IFRS), serving as the baseline for assessing the true financial health of retail operations and inventory management strategies used by businesses worldwide.
Accountants, inventory managers, and small business owners rely on this method to maintain accurate balance sheets. By tracking how specific purchase batches flow out the door, these professionals avoid the pitfalls of using outdated average costs. Whether it’s a boutique bakery managing flour supplies or an electronics retailer tracking serial-numbered devices, the precision afforded by this calculation ensures that margins are calculated against the specific procurement price of the items sold.
An inventory layer represents a distinct batch of goods purchased at a specific unit cost. Since market prices fluctuate, a business often holds several layers simultaneously. Tracking these layers is essential, as the calculator must deplete the oldest layer entirely before moving to the cost of the next, ensuring your cost of goods sold remains tethered to the actual historical price of the oldest available inventory.
This metric represents the direct costs of producing the goods sold by a company. In a FIFO system, COGS is calculated by summing the costs of the oldest inventory units first. As you sell items, the calculator pulls from the earliest available layers, creating a logical financial sequence that directly impacts your gross profit and determines your taxable income for the specific fiscal period.
At the end of an accounting period, your balance sheet must show the value of items remaining in stock. Because FIFO assumes the oldest goods are sold, the ending inventory is valued using the costs of the most recent acquisitions. This ensures that the balance sheet reflects current market replacement costs, providing investors and stakeholders with an accurate picture of the business’s current asset value and liquidity.
This concept measures how quickly a business sells its stock over a given period. By utilizing FIFO, you ensure the cost basis for your turnover calculation is consistent and reflective of actual sales cycles. High turnover suggests efficient inventory management, while stagnant layers indicate a need to adjust purchasing habits. This calculator provides the underlying cost data needed to derive these crucial efficiency metrics for your business.
This refers to the chronological order in which inventory is removed from your ledger. The FIFO logic mandates that the "first-in" units must be cleared before the "next-in" units can be assigned to COGS. By strictly adhering to this sequence, you avoid the distortions that occur when costs are blended, allowing for precise tracking of profit margins on a per-batch or per-acquisition basis throughout the year.
Enter your inventory purchase data, including the quantity and unit cost of each batch, followed by the total number of units sold. The calculator then sequences these inputs to extract the total cost of goods sold and the value of your remaining stock.
Input your purchase history into the "Quantity" and "Cost per Unit" fields, starting with the oldest batch. For example, enter "100 units" at "$5.00" for your first shipment received in January to establish your primary inventory layer.
Add subsequent batches in chronological order of receipt. If you received another "150 units" at "$5.50" in February, input these into the second layer to ensure the calculator maintains the correct FIFO sequence for your cost analysis.
Enter the total number of units sold during the period into the "Units Sold" field. The calculator automatically computes the total COGS by drawing from the oldest layers first until the total unit count is satisfied.
Review the final output, which displays the total COGS and the value of the remaining inventory. Use these figures to update your financial statements and assess your gross profit margins based on the actual historical costs.
Imagine you are running a seasonal clothing shop and you receive a surprise discount on a bulk shipment of winter jackets. Do not lump this discounted batch into your existing inventory count without specifying the unit cost separately. By failing to create a distinct layer for this new, cheaper batch, you artificially inflate your COGS calculation for later sales, leading to inaccurate profit reporting and potential tax discrepancies. Always keep cost batches distinct to ensure your FIFO logic remains perfectly aligned.
The core logic of the FIFO method is a recursive depletion process where the quantity sold is subtracted from inventory layers starting from the oldest. If the number of units sold exceeds the quantity in the first layer, the calculator exhausts that layer and moves to the second, continuing until the total "Units Sold" value is reached. This process assumes that inventory is homogeneous within a batch, meaning every unit in a specific purchase is identical in cost. While mathematically sound, it is most accurate when purchase prices are stable or clearly documented by invoice date; it becomes less precise if items are mixed in storage without regard to their arrival sequence. By using this formula, you effectively isolate the specific cost of your sales against the chronological order of your inventory procurement.
COGS = Σ (Q_i × C_i) for all fully consumed layers i + (Q_remaining × C_next)
COGS = total cost of goods sold in dollars; Q_i = quantity of units in the i-th oldest layer; C_i = cost per unit of the i-th oldest layer; Q_remaining = units sold from the final, partially consumed layer; C_next = cost per unit of the final, partially consumed layer.
Sarah, an owner of a local hardware store, needs to calculate the profit on a bulk sale of high-end cordless drills. She has two batches: 50 drills bought at $80 each and 70 drills bought at $90 each. She sells 75 drills today. Sarah must determine the exact COGS for these 75 units to finalize her quarterly earnings report.
Sarah starts by reviewing her purchase logs to ensure she has the correct sequence. She knows her first layer consists of 50 drills at $80 per unit, while her second layer contains 70 drills at $90 per unit. Because she is using the FIFO method, she understands that the first 50 drills sold must be drawn from the $80 batch. Once those 50 are accounted for, she must pull the remaining 25 drills from the second, more expensive $90 batch. By substituting these figures into the FIFO calculation, she multiplies 50 by $80 to get $4,000 for the first layer. Then, she multiplies the remaining 25 drills by $90 to get $2,250 for the second portion of the sale. Adding these two figures together gives her a total COGS of $6,250. This specific breakdown allows Sarah to report her exact profit margin for the sale, ensuring her financial records are consistent and compliant. By distinguishing between these two cost layers, she avoids the mistake of averaging the costs, which would have hidden the impact of the price increase in her second shipment. She can now confidently present her profit margins to her business partners, knowing the numbers are backed by the chronological reality of her stock.
COGS = (Units_Layer1 * Cost_Layer1) + (Units_Remaining * Cost_Layer2)
COGS = (50 * $80) + (25 * $90)
COGS = $4,000 + $2,250 = $6,250
Sarah now has an accurate COGS of $6,250 for her sale of 75 drills. This precision allows her to see that her gross profit is slightly lower than if she had only considered the first batch, helping her set better retail prices for future shipments. She feels confident in her quarterly reporting and can now make an informed decision on her pricing strategy.
The FIFO method is not merely an accounting requirement; it is a vital tool for managing the financial flow of goods in various professional and personal settings.
Retail Management: A boutique owner uses this to calculate exact daily margins on clothing sales, ensuring that price tags reflect the specific cost of older stock versus newer, more expensive seasonal inventory arriving in the warehouse throughout the year for better financial clarity.
Food Service: A restaurant manager tracks the cost of perishable ingredients, such as wholesale meat or produce, to ensure that the oldest items are expensed first, preventing inaccurate accounting and minimizing waste-related financial losses that can occur when old stock sits on the shelf.
Personal Budgeting: A home-based hobbyist selling handmade goods tracks the cost of raw materials like fabric or wood, using the calculator to understand how rising material costs affect the profit margin of their individual craft sales across different production cycles.
Electronics Distribution: A tech supplier uses this to manage serial-numbered inventory where hardware costs fluctuate due to component shortages, ensuring that each sale is correctly attributed to the specific purchase price of that unit to maintain accurate profitability reports.
Digital Asset Accounting: A platform manager tracks the cost of digital subscriptions or license keys purchased in bulk, ensuring that the oldest, lower-cost licenses are expensed first to maintain accurate profitability reporting for the digital business unit in a modern landscape.
The users of this calculator are united by the need for financial precision in a world of volatile supply chains. Whether they are managing a small retail shop, a warehouse, or an e-commerce operation, these professionals seek to bridge the gap between physical stock movement and accounting reality. They share the goal of producing accurate profit-and-loss statements that reflect the true historical cost of the items they sell. By using this tool, they gain a clear, defensible view of their business performance, allowing them to make strategic purchasing and pricing decisions that protect their bottom line effectively.
Retail Store Owners
Need to determine the cost of sold items to maintain accurate profit margins during fluctuating market prices.
Warehouse Managers
Require precise tracking of stock age to ensure financial reports match the physical rotation of goods.
Small Business Accountants
Rely on this tool to verify COGS figures for quarterly tax preparations and financial audits.
E-commerce Sellers
Use this to analyze the profitability of specific product batches when sourcing goods from multiple suppliers.
Supply Chain Analysts
Need this to evaluate how historical purchase costs impact the overall efficiency of inventory turnover.
Separate your inventory batches: Many users make the mistake of aggregating all their stock into one pool. When costs fluctuate, this blending masks the true COGS. Instead, always record each purchase as a distinct layer with its own cost per unit. This allows the FIFO calculator to accurately deplete the oldest, cheapest, or most expensive layers correctly, providing a granular view of your profit margins that aggregate averages simply cannot provide.
Align your ledger with physical reality: A common error is assuming FIFO is just a tax strategy, but it must reflect your actual warehouse flow. If you are selling items that have been sitting in the back for six months, those costs must be the first ones recognized in your COGS. Ensure that your physical stock rotation matches your accounting entries to avoid discrepancies during your year-end inventory audit.
Account for returns correctly: When a customer returns an item, it should ideally be re-integrated into your inventory at its original cost. If you treat returns as new inventory at current market prices, you will distort your FIFO sequence. Always track the original purchase cost for returned items to ensure your inventory valuation remains consistent and your cost of goods sold is not artificially inflated or deflated.
Check your units of measure: Users frequently mix up units, such as entering dozens in one field and individual pieces in another. This discrepancy will throw off your entire calculation. Ensure that your "Quantity" and "Units Sold" are measured in the same unit of measure—whether that is by the box, the kilogram, or the individual piece—before you run your calculation to ensure that the cost attribution is mathematically valid.
Update layers after every purchase: The biggest mistake is failing to input a new batch as soon as it is received. When you delay updating your inventory layers, your COGS calculations will continue to pull from outdated, exhausted stock. By maintaining a real-time record of your inventory arrivals, you ensure that every sale is calculated against the correct, current historical cost, keeping your financial statements accurate and your profit analysis reliable.
Accurate & Reliable
The FIFO method is a cornerstone of the International Financial Reporting Standards (IFRS) and is widely accepted by tax authorities globally. By strictly following the cost flow of your goods, this calculator aligns your business practices with standard accounting principles, ensuring your financial reporting is both professional and defensible during any external audit or tax review process.
Instant Results
When you are staring down a quarterly reporting deadline, there is no time to manually reconcile spreadsheets. This calculator provides an immediate, verified result, allowing you to finalize your COGS figures in seconds so you can spend your time analyzing business trends rather than performing repetitive arithmetic on your purchase logs.
Works on Any Device
Imagine you are on the floor of your warehouse with a tablet in hand. You need to know if a specific sale is profitable before committing to a bulk discount for a client. This mobile-friendly tool lets you perform the calculation instantly, giving you the immediate insight required to negotiate confidently and protect your margins.
Completely Private
Your inventory data contains sensitive pricing information and supplier details that define your competitive edge. This tool performs all calculations locally within your browser, ensuring that your raw purchase data and calculated costs never leave your device or reach a third-party server, keeping your private business intelligence completely secure and confidential.
Browse calculators by topic
Related articles and insights
Signing a mortgage is one of the biggest financial commitments of your life. Make sure you understand the difference between FRM and ARM loans involving thousands of dollars.
Feb 15, 2026
Climate change is a global problem, but the solution starts locally. Learn what a carbon footprint is and actionable steps to reduce yours.
Feb 08, 2026
Is there a mathematical formula for beauty? Explore the Golden Ratio (Phi) and how it appears in everything from hurricanes to the Mona Lisa.
Feb 01, 2026